About the Item
18th century Italian bronze-gold crucifix with coordinating gold leaf shells and crystal points mounted on a crystal geode. The gold leaf shells adorn the crucifix and the base of the mineral. The geode crystal was part of a large geode and perfectly matches with the crucifix and gold leaf shells. The shells and crystal points rise out geode to appear as if the piece evolved together over time.
The piece is put together by Jean O'Reilly Barlow, the artist and creative director of Interi. The date of manufacture reflects when she transformed the piece and the period shows that the Italian crucifix is originally 18th century.
The Italian crosses are preserved and transformed into a figurative, contemporary work of art. With the combination of organic elements, the church artifact becomes a sculptural work of historic and organic significance.
Interi is known for its precious collections of sculptural ecclesiastical artifacts. Recently Interi exhibited The Crucifix Collection with Museo de' Medici in Florence, Italy which just closed April 21st, 2024.

Crucifix on Calvary, Called Plague of Christ, France, Early 18th Century
Located in Milan, IT
Crucifix on Calvary, called 'Pestis Christi' or Crucifiix Pestis 'Plague of Christ' or Plague Crucifix). The sculpture is composite, made with heterogeneous materials: wax, wood, papier-mâché. The octagonal base is slightly raised and supports the calvary, symbolized by rocks, from which the crucifix rises, made with intentionally unfinished boards and with marked veins. The depicted Christ is peculiar: he shows scarified skin all over his body. Masterfully crafted in wax. They are the plagues of the plague that Christ, 'Agnus Dei' takes charge of with salvific value, for the salvation of the world. At his feet the ordeal full of symbols: evil (snake) with the apple, the 'Memento mori' of human bones...
